You won't be able to see the + and - signs near the coil if you close the door, so I'm not sure what you are seeing. You don't close the door of the anti-vamp system until you have it all done. I assume you developed the picture in the photo developer underneath the anti-vamp system.

Then you put it together. I'm just copying and pasting from the walkthrough which is quite clear.

1. Place the resistor/u-shaped object on top. Look close on the round object at the center of the resistor and set it to 8 using the +/- icon.


2. Place the electrolysis tube in front of the u-shaped object. Look close at needlelike part of resistor and adjust it to 4 using the +/- icon.


3. Place the ammeter/white square box on the middle left and the rheostat/coiled wires at the bottom. Look close on the coiled wire and adjust the ammeter setting to 7 using the +/- icons.

Once you have done these things, then remove the antenna that Dr. Seward said is not working well and replace it with the tuning fork obtained from the Dracula robot.

NOW you can close the anti-vamp system and take the crank on the right side.
